Shader Tip Burn Pens

Shader tips are among the best wood-burning pen tips for beginners. They are a spoon-like shape that stops the edges from digging into the wood when shading. They can be used on convex and flat surfaces. They are ideal for stippling or making lighter shading. They are ideal for filling in letters and outlines, but they can be used for many other things.

When shading, it is essential to work quickly so that lines do not get darker than you intended. It is also an excellent idea to work in circular motions. You can also shade using hatching. This involves drawing thin lines one way, and then cross-hatching them with those drawn in the opposite direction. It gives a more dark appearance than straight lines and is extremely efficient for fur, hair, scale, feathers and other nature designs.

Sweeping is a different technique for burning wood that can help to create more realistic fur, eyelashes and grass in your designs. It's more time consuming than other shading techniques, but it produces very natural results.

The pulling technique can be used to shade straight and curvy lines. It is crucial to move your pen downwards toward yourself when using this method to avoid unwanted chunks. It is also essential to use the least amount of pressure since pushing the pen into the wood can damage it.

Wood Burning Tips

To avoid breathing in harmful fumes, its important to work in an area that is well ventilated. We recommend a tool for smoke extraction like the GourdMaster Wood Burning Buddy II to assist you in this. It will not only capture the fumes, but it will also help to remove the smoke from your air to allow you to work longer and more comfortably.

You can also improve your skills in wood burning by working with scrap wood prior to starting working on your project. This will allow you to gain an understanding of how the tool functions and how you can use it to create your ideal design. You can also experiment with different tip sizes and shapes to see what works best for you.

When you're working on your project it is essential to take your time and take your time. Your finished design will show when you rush. Make sure you prepare your work area and cover any items that might melt by using a dropcloth.

The kind of wood you select is another important factor. Choose soft, smooth woods with a minimal grain. Harder, dense woods require more heat and could cause a bumpy mess. Avoid knotted woods since they are difficult to work with and may cause unpredictable results.
